Study On The New Development Of Anti-dumping Law Of The European Union

In 2018,the EU modernised its' basic anti-dumping and anti-subsidy regulations.Along with the changes on calculating dumping margins introduced in December 2017,this modernisation of the legislation is the first major revamp of the EU's trade defence instruments in the past 15 years.And the anti-dumping rules have undergone major changes.As the country with the most anti-dumping investigations initiated by the EU,this is bound to have an important impact on China.The EU anti-dumping rules involve changes in both substantive rules and procedural rules.The content of the amendments to the substantive rules has caused widespread concern and has been seriously questioned.The main contents include the concept and standard of “serious market distortion”,the new normal value calculation method,and the restriction from the lesser duty rules.Although the EU claims that the revision of the anti-dumping rules is aimed at making the anti-dumping trade defence instruments continue to be effective in the face of global challenges,it can be found that the revision of anti-dumping rules has a strong color of protectionism and the negative impact on fair and free multilateral trade is even more obvious.China should take active measures to deal with the new EU anti-dumping rules on the premise of fully understanding the new EU anti-dumping rules,so as to reduce the damage to Chinese enterprises caused by the new EU anti-dumping rules.The article is divided into six parts,focusing on the three main rules that have the development and changes:The first introduces the basic content of the EU anti-dumping law,then analyzes the relationship between the EU anti-dumping law and the WTO multilateral anti-dumping rules,and finally,on the basis of sorting out the historical development of the EU anti-dumping law,this paper analyzes the reasons for the new development of the EU anti-dumping law.The second part is the new "serious market distortion" rule.Firstly,it introduces the specific content of the new "market severe distortion" rule.And then points out the characteristics of the new rule through comparison with the rules of non-market economy countries.Finally,it points out that the new rules break through the WTO rules,confuse the concept of anti-dumping and countervailing,violate the Anti-dumping Agreement and other issues.The third part is about the new development of the rules of the normal value calculation method in the EU anti-dumping law.Firstly,it introduces the specific provisions of the new rules.By comparing with the "substitute country method" and the cost adjustment method,the essence of the new rule "old wine in a new bottle " is pointed out.Finally,combined with specific cases,the new calculation method is inconsistent with the WTO multilateral anti-dumping rules.The fourth part takes the development and changes of the lesser duty rules in the modernization reform of EU trade defence instruments as the main content,and first introduces the main contents of the revision of the lesser duty rules.After that,the problems of introducing "raw material distortion",labor and environmental standards into the lesser duty rules were pointed out.The fifth part is the impact of the new development of EU anti-dumping law,including the impact on the WTO multilateral trading system,and the challenges brought to China by the new rules in the future EU anti-dumping against China.The sixth part is aimed at the problems existing in the EU's new anti-dumping rules and the challenges that China will face.In combination with China's reality,the sixth part puts forward some suggestions for the government and enterprises should respond to the EU's new anti-dumping rules and provide a way to safeguard China's legitimate rights and interests under the unfair international anti-dumping rules.
